选择适合Web3开发与应用的电脑:全面指南

引言:拥抱Web3的未来

在数字化浪潮不断推进的今天,Web3已经成为技术发展的一个重要趋势。不仅涉及区块链技术,还涵盖去中心化应用(DApps)、智能合约等多个领域。在这种背景下,选择一台合适的电脑自然成为了开发者和用户必须面对的问题。“一日之计在于晨”,早买电脑,早享受Web3的魅力。

Web3概述:背景与发展

选择适合Web3开发与应用的电脑:全面指南

Web3是互联网发展的下一步,是以去中心化为核心的一种全新网络模式。相比于以往的中心化互联网,在Web3中,用户的数据和隐私权益得到了更好的保护。在这种环境中,开发者需要具备一定编程能力,而选择合适的设备则成为了每个开发者的首要任务。正如老话所说:“工欲善其事,必先利其器”。

Web3开发所需的基本配置

在选择电脑时,首先要考虑的是其硬件配置。Web3开发多涉及到较重的计算工作,因此一台高性能的电脑是必不可少的。以下是一些推荐的基本配置:

  • 处理器:建议使用至少四核的处理器,例如Intel Core i5或者AMD Ryzen 5及以上。强劲的处理器可以大幅提升编译和运行代码的速度。
  • 内存:至少16GB的RAM,可以让你同时运行多个开发环境而不感到卡顿。
  • 存储:选择SSD固态硬盘,建议容量256GB以上,确保软件的快速加载和文件的读写速度。
  • 显卡:虽然Web3开发不一定需要高性能的显卡,但如果你涉及到图形或者区块链游戏相关的开发,建议选择一款中高档显卡。

推荐电脑型号

选择适合Web3开发与应用的电脑:全面指南

接下来,我们来看看一些市场上较为热门的电脑型号,适合Web3开发者使用:

  • Dell XPS 15:这款电脑以其出色的显示效果和强大的性能而受到推崇,非常适合开发者使用。
  • MacBook Pro:苹果的操作系统对开发者友好,尤其是在区块链开发上,许多开发工具在macOS上表现更佳。
  • Lenovo ThinkPad X1 Carbon:凭借其强大的性能和优良的键盘体验,成为很多程序员的爱机。
  • Asus ROG Zephyrus:这款游戏本也适合进行Web3开发,良好的散热和性能表现让人满意。

操作系统的选择

除了硬件,操作系统的选择也非常重要。对于Web3开发,一般有以下几种选择:

  • Linux:许多开发者喜欢使用Linux系统,因为它的开源特性使得各种开发工具的兼容性极好。
  • macOS:提供优质的开发环境,适合进行多种编程语言的开发,许多区块链开发者倾向于使用这个系统。
  • Windows:绝大多数开发工具在Windows上也可以运行,因此如果你习惯了这个操作系统,完全可以继续使用。

开发工具与软件推荐

选择合适的开发工具同样关乎开发效率。Web3开发通常涉及以下几种工具和软件:

  • 文本编辑器:如Visual Studio Code、Sublime Text等,帮助你高效书写代码。
  • 区块链开发框架:如Truffle、Hardhat等,提供便捷的智能合约开发环境。
  • 版本管理工具:Git无疑是每个开发者的必备工具,确保代码的版本控制和团队协作。
  • 虚拟机:如Docker,可以帮助你在本地环境中轻松测试和部署区块链应用。

网络和安全性

在Web3世界中,安全性显得尤为重要,因此请选择支持VPN的网络环境,以保障你的开发活动的安全。网络的延迟和稳定性也会直接影响开发体验,因此,配置良好的网络环境也不能忽视。

总结:智慧选择助力Web3之旅

总之,选择一台合适的电脑对于Web3开发是至关重要的。从硬件配置到操作系统,从软件工具到网络环境,每一步都需谨慎对待。“千里之行,始于足下”,通过合理的选择和配置,你将能够高效地进行Web3开发,迎接未来的无限可能。

希望本指南能够帮助你找到适合自己需求的电脑,并在Web3的道路上越走越远,尽情享受技术进步带来的乐趣和便利!